简单来说是否需要安装应用,需要知道应用的url schemes,不然没有办法判断
如果A应用跳转B应用,在需要在B应用里面添加一下字段:
project->targets->info->URL TYPES 配置一下字段
A银通的配置文档:LSApplicationQueriesSchemes配置B应用的url schemes
NSURL *url = [NSURL URLWithString:@"aaa://"]; if([[UIApplication sharedApplication]canOpenURL:url]){ [[UIApplication sharedApplication]openURL:url]; }else{ //未安装 }